Rapid confirmatory assay for the simultaneous detection of ronidazole, metronidazole and dimetridazole in eggs using liquid chromatography-tandem mass spectrometry

A relatively fast, sensitive and very selective high-performance liquid chromatography-tandem mass spectrometry method for the detection of ronidazole, metronidazole and dimetridazole in eggs has been developed. After a simple extraction with acetonitrile and evaporation of the organic solvent, the extract was filtered and directly injected into the LC-MS-MS system on a C18 column. The abundant parent ions [M + H]+ produced by positive electrospray ionisation were selected for fragmentation with argon. Validation parameters such as detection limit, recovery, linearity and repeatability were determined. The advantage of this method over existing methods is the very simple sample pre-treatment and the high specificity due to the multiple reaction monitoring (MRM) transitions.
